Keystone Style Commandments
===========================
- Step 1: Read the OpenStack Style Commandments
http://docs.openstack.org/developer/hacking/
- Step 2: Read on
Keystone Specific Commandments
------------------------------
- Avoid using "double quotes" where you can reasonably use 'single quotes'
TODO vs FIXME
-------------
- TODO(name): implies that something should be done (cleanup, refactoring,
etc), but is expected to be functional.
- FIXME(name): implies that the method/function/etc shouldn't be used until
that code is resolved and bug fixed.
Logging
-------
Use the common logging module, and ensure you ``getLogger``::
from keystone.openstack.common import log
LOG = log.getLogger(__name__)
LOG.debug('Foobar')
AssertEqual argument order
--------------------------
assertEqual method's arguments should be in ('expected', 'actual') order.
